Dr. Price joined the practice in August of 2011. She grew up in Scottsdale before attending the University of Arizona in Tucson. She graduated summa cum laude with a double major in molecular & cellular biology and psychology and was granted membership into Phi Beta Kappa. She then finished at the top of the 2004 University of Arizona’s medical school class. In addition, she accomplished a full pediatric residency at the University of California, Los Angeles (UCLA) and became board certified in pediatrics. Subsequently, she completed her dermatology residency at the University of Miami/Jackson Memorial Hospital, one of the top dermatology training programs in the country, where she was honored to serve as chief resident. She also received specialized training at the University of Miami with a clinical research fellowship in pediatric dermatology and was a principle investigator for a multi-center research trial on infantile hemangiomas, which recently achieved national recognition.
Dr. Price is a fellow of the American Academy of Dermatology and the American Academy of Pediatrics. She is also a member of the Women’s Dermatology Society, the American Medical Association, and the Society for Pediatric Dermatology. She has been an active volunteer within her community for over a decade, serving indigent patients without access to healthcare as well as educating the community on sun safety/awareness and performing skin cancer screenings. Her fluency in medical Spanish has enabled her to volunteer abroad in places such as Costa Rica and Mexico. She has over 30 publications within the field of dermatology, is an active speaker at national conferences, and is dedicated to teaching, research, and the enhancement of skin diseases in patients of all ages. She specializes in general medical & pediatric dermatology, skin cancer surgery and cosmetics.
